A wireless frequency meter is a device used to measure the frequency of an output signal of any electrical device situated in a remote location. Our designed wireless frequency meter typically displays numerical values of the frequency in an LCD module in the unit of Hz or KHz. It consists of two major parts: 1) Line frequency counter and 2) Remote Display Module. Line frequency counter consists of three major section which are i) signal input, ii) Micro controller, iii) RF transmitter whereas the remote display module also consists of three parts i) RF Receiver, ii) Microcontroller and iii) LCD Display Module. The Receiver Module can be set up at a maximum distance of 150 meters from the transmitter. It is possible to have more than one receiver for a transmitter. This meter can measure frequencies up to 125 KHz and is very much useful for various industrial applications at a cost of Tk. 1850 only. The main attraction of our designed circuit is the simplicity of the circuit, easiness of implementation and the availability of components required in Bangladesh.
